GROUP 6.-SPIRITS, WINES, MALT, AND OTHER BEVERAGES.

For the purpose of assessment under those paragraphs in which the proof liter is the basis, each and every gauge or wine liter of measurement shall be counted as at least one proof liter. All imitations of whisky, rum, gin, brandy, spirits, or wines, imported by or under any names whatsoever shall be subjected to the highest rate of duty provided for the genuine articles respectively intended to be represented, with a surtax of fifty per centum.

Alcohol, spirits, etc. 257. Alcohol, proof liter, fifty cents.

258. Whisky, rum, gin, brandy, and other spirits not otherwise pro-
vided for, proof liter, fifty cents.

259. Blackberry and ginger brandy, proof liter, thirty cents.
260. Cocktails, liqueurs, cordials, and other compounded spirituous
beverages and bitters, not otherwise provided for, proof liter,
sixty-five cents.

261. Wines, sparkling, liter, one dollar.

262. Still wines, vermouth, and sake, containing fourteen per centum or less of alcohol:

(a) In receptacles containing each more than two liters, liter, two cents.

(b) In receptacles containing each two liters or less, liter, seven and one-half cents.

Provided, That no article classified under this paragraph shall pay a less rate of duty than forty per centum ad valorem.

263. Still wines, vermouth, and sake, containing more than fourteen per centum of alcohol:

(a) In receptacles containing each more than two liters, liter, fifteen cents.

(b) In receptacles containing each two liters or less, liter, twenty-five cents.

Provided, That no article classified under this paragraph shall pay a less rate of duty than fifty per centum ad valorem; and

Provided further, That any of such articles containing more than twenty-four per centum of alcohol shall be classified under paragraph two hundred and sixty.
